9S19M Imbir (Cyrillic: 9С19 «Имбирь», NATO-designator: High Screen) is operating in the X-Band mobile air surveillance and acquisition radar for S-300V/SA-12 Anti-Ballistic Missile (ABM) systems.
The transmitter uses a high power Traveling Wave Tube (TWT). The transmission type of space feeded phased array antenna scans a sector of 90 degrees in azimuth, and 30 to 73 degrees in elevation.
